  • Patent number: 11974115
    Abstract: An active sound design (ASD) tuning device and a method thereof may include an ASD device that generates a virtual engine sound for each vehicle situation and a control device that outputs a composite sound by correcting and synthesizing the virtual engine sound and an internal sound measured for each vehicle situation based on a binaural vehicle impulse response (BVIR).

  • Patent number: 11919446
    Abstract: An apparatus and a method for generating a sound of an electric vehicle are provided. The apparatus determines whether a current condition may be a regenerative braking condition, generates a regenerative braking sound based on an amount of change in motor torque in the regenerative braking condition, and outputs the generated regenerative braking sound.

  • Patent number: 11268793
    Abstract: The present disclosure relates to a detonation connector having an exposure part for tagging, the detonation connector includes: an electrically conductive wire-connecting bracket member having a plurality of electric wire mounting grooves to which a leg line or a leading line is mounted; a lower casing member at which the wire-connecting bracket member is positioned; and an upper casing member covering the lower casing member, wherein the upper casing member or the lower casing member is provided with a tagging exposure part that exposes a part of the wire-connecting bracket member wire-connecting the leg line and the leading line, so that the tagging work of charging initialization time to a detonator can be performed without opening the upper casing member, and the convenience and the efficiency of the tagging work can be improved.

  • Publication number: 20210356246
    Abstract: Provided is an operator terminal for a blasting system. The terminal includes a logging unit that acquires detonation information on a detonator using a logging scheme, a scanning unit that acquires the detonation information using a scanning scheme, and a control unit that receives the detonation information, matches the detonation information and design information to each other, and transfers setting information corresponding to the detonation information to the detonator. The logging scheme is a scheme of acquiring the detonation information through a detonation wire connected to the detonator, and the scanning scheme is a scheme of capturing an identification image and thus acquiring the detonation information.

  • Patent number: 11131534
    Abstract: The present disclosure relates to a connector for a blast-triggering device, said connector including a connector head in which a rear end thereof is integrally connected with a rear surface of a connector body, an upper surface thereof is formed in a curved surface extending from the rear end thereof to a front end thereof, a tube insertion portion is provided between a lower surface thereof and the connector body so that a plurality of shock tubes is fitted therein, and the front end thereof is separated from the connector body. Thus, it is possible to maintain the shape of the connector during detonation, thereby minimizing the generation of debris and improving the safety at the time of detonation. In addition, it is possible to prevent damage to the plurality of shock tubes, thereby preventing a cut-off phenomenon caused by damaged shock tubes during detonation.

  • Patent number: 11054235
    Abstract: The present disclosure relates to a trunkline delay detonator and a blast-triggering device using the same. In the blast-triggering device, a trunkline delay detonator is inserted into a connector in such a manner that a plurality of shock tubes connected to a detonator for initiating an explosive are interposed between the connector and the trunkline delay detonator, so that an explosion signal is applied to the shock tubes by detonation of the trunkline delay detonator. In the blasting detonator, close contact between the outer surface of the trunkline delay detonator and the shock tubes is improved, whereby energy lost in an explosion is reduced and an explosion signal is stably and uniformly applied to the shock tubes by using powder which has a weak explosive power and is relatively insensitive compared to conventional powders.

  • Patent number: 10680844
    Abstract: An apparatus, method, and system for providing information for a wireless network connection using Wi-Fi. Device information for at least one UPnP device is provided from a plurality of wireless devices including the at least one UPnP device, a device information announcement message including the device information for the at least one UPnP device is generated, and the generated device information announcement message is broadcasted. In this way, information on a UPnP device to which to connect a wireless device is provided in advance, and a user can easily perform a network connection.
